Transaction 01abf0d30224f3d2355d078fc084cf16737fcc7feaaceb2edf9c69a853d0d76a

33 Input
1 Outputs
  • 01abf0d30224f3d2355d078fc084cf16737fcc7feaaceb2edf9c69a853d0d76a:0
  • value  523196481
    address  1EDun84Eynt6kRNdFiYuZ2Zesh4yj35GgR